Back End Developer (Golang)


Back End Developer (Golang)

Back End Developer (Golang)


Key Skills: Web Technologies Socket Programming Concurrent Programming Internet Protocol Suite (Tcp/Ip) Transmission Control Protocol (Tcp)

Back End Developer (Golang)

Views: 87 | This job is expired 1 week, 1 day ago

Basic Job Information

Job Category : IT & Telecommunication
Job Level : Entry Level
No. of Vacancy/s : [ 1 ]
Employment Type : Full Time
Job Location : Kathmandu
Apply Before(Deadline) : Jun. 10, 2024 23:30 (1 week, 1 day ago)

Job Specification

Experience Required : Not Required
Professional Skill Required : Web Technologies Socket Programming Concurrent Programming Internet Protocol Suite (Tcp/Ip) Transmission Control Protocol (Tcp)

About the job

At BerryBytes, we work in a collaborative and innovative work environment, with brilliant and passionate people who strive and encourage others to do their best. BerryBytes welcomes creative and sometimes unconventional perspectives! With its upcoming 01cloud PaaS offerings, it is making its mark on the new Developer Experience (DX) and NoOps offerings that empower any user to run any workloads in large distributed clusters.

Be part of the exciting product development journey with cutting edge technologies that will soon dominate the industry. 

About the Role.

We are building a Cloud Agnostic PaaS product around Kubernetes that aimis to reduce significant time to roll out the Cloud Native application across the managed or on premise.

We are looking for a Software Engineer for our cloud native PaaS product that leverages innovative technologies and cloud services. The ideal candidate will have strong experience developing rich and intuitive consumer-facing products or highly integrated and concurrent enterprise applications.

Job Description and Responsibilities

  • We’re looking for an experienced Software Engineer with GoLang to join our team. Your core responsibilities will include:
  • Responsible for the development and maintenance of key product features
  • Work with other team members to investigate design approaches, prototype new technology, and evaluate technical feasibility.
  • Will work in a fast-paced environment to deliver high-quality software against aggressive schedules.
  • Prepare technical requirements and software design specifications
  • Install and support systems used internally by development
  • Responsible for helping to document the software

Technical Skills

  • Strong in Go Concurrency.
  • Knowledge Operating system internals.
  • Knowledge of TCP/IP networking and common web technologies ‘
  • Ability to work independently while managing multiple task assignments.
  • Strong initiative, written, and verbal communication skills.
  • Experience with any of the following technologies a plus
  • Solid experience in Multi-threaded and Concurrent programming
  • TCP/IP socket programming
  • Familiarity with GoLang leading OpenSource libraries
  • Static and dynamic analysis tools
  • Working knowledge of encryption tools and technologies
  • NoSQL and Relational Databases experience
  • ElastiSearch and RabbitMQ experience a plus.

Nice to Have

  • Experience with Docker and Kubernetes is a plus.
  • Experience in CI/CD and DevOps processes. 
  • Willing to learn Rust

This job has expired.

Recommended Jobs

Job Action

Similar Jobs
Powered by Merojob AI
Most Viewed Jobs
Search, Apply & Get Job: FREE